What is a Data Science R job?

A Data Science R job involves using the R programming language for data analysis, statistical modeling, and machine learning. Professionals in this role work with large datasets, clean and preprocess data, apply predictive modeling techniques, and visualize insights. They often use libraries like ggplot2, dplyr, and caret to manipulate data and build models. This role is common in industries such as finance, healthcare, and marketing, where data-driven decision-making is essential. Strong statistical knowledge, programming skills, and domain expertise are key to success in this position.

What are the typical daily tasks for a Data Science R professional in most organizations?

In most organizations, Data Science R professionals spend their days gathering and cleaning data, performing exploratory data analysis with R, building and evaluating predictive models, and generating data visualizations to communicate results. They often meet with cross-functional teams to understand business needs, translate them into data projects, and present key findings. Additionally, they may write reproducible R scripts, maintain data pipelines, and document their methodologies. Collaboration, experimentation, and clear communication are integral parts of the role, enabling solutions that directly impact business out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Data Science R position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Science R professional, you need solid expertise in statistics, machine learning, and programming in R, often supported by a degree in data science, statistics, or a related field. Experience with R-based data analysis libraries, visualization tools like ggplot2, and familiarity with databases or cloud platforms is typically expected; certifications in data science or R programming can be advantageous.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ication with stakeholders help distinguish top performers in this role. These skills are essential for delivering actionable insights from complex datasets and driving data-informed decision-making within organizations.
